We had a great stay! Not in the centre of town, but not far away at all. A 30peso taxi ride from the ADO station. A 5 minute walk to the main Plaza. We had a small, but clean and tidy private room. Everything you would expect and hope from a hostel, for a good price. We had a great time and met loads of cool people there. San Cristobel is well worth checking out, and I would imagine there are not many better places to stay than Iguana Hostel

I enjoyed my stay here. The staff were friendly and the atmosphere and location were good. The only thing I disliked was that much of the common area is more outside, which can be an issue at night since it gets cold.

Iguana Hostel is the best hostel I have ever stayed in. The staff there are super nice and welcoming. Breakfast is cooked by them every morning. Perfect place to meet friends and look for travel companions. Yet, there is no hot water shower in the female dorm, so one has to go to the public one, but it is just a minor problem and the shower in the public bathroom is perfect.

I loved the staff and other visitors at Iguana (and the breakfast is good), but the communal bathrooms seemed to never be cleaned and the door to the dorm is always open, so anything that doesn´t fit in the locker is just out for anyone with a front door key.

The hostel looks better in photos,its ok but they have some issues to address: 1)The downstairs bathroom is dirty the most of the times and nobody did anything about it,i found a big spider inside and i had to take it out cause nobody was taking care about it. 2)The room that i was in was plain and a bit dark. 3)The staff is cool they dont speak spanish that is an issue in México.

You get what you pay for. This place is nothing fancy. But the mattresses were good, Internet kitchen wi fi hammock in the sun. Excellent location. For that price - can't complain.
